« Reply #6 on: November 30, 2009, 05:25:55 PM »

Thanks, Ive been thinking about getting some of those and good you recommended them. Its kinda hard to find reviews of these things?

Yeah . . . but you can rely on the opinions of people in this forum.  In fact, badmovies.org contributors probably own 75% of all the 50 movie packs that have ever been sold.

There are 2 sets you should beware of:

* WARRIORS - it has 50 of the Hercules, Samson, etc., movies, mostly from the 1960s.  The color is sort of washed out on many of them.  Still watchable, but many Mill Creek sets have better quality.

* HOLLYWOOD LEGENDS - it has a mixture of old, black & white movies (some of them are actually very good) and color movies from the 1970s.  Unfortunately, some of the color movies in this set have obviously been edited . . . they may be "television" versions of R-rated movies.
